Bright Smart Securities: Mandatory general offer possible
Securities filings show that Morgan Stanley & Co., International plc engaged in share dealings of Bright Smart Securities & Commodities Group on July 8, 2025, as part of hedging activities related to Delta 1 products created from unsolicited client-driven orders. Morgan Stanley purchased 1,398,000 ordinary shares at prices ranging from $9.2000 to $10.6800, totaling USD 14,381,038.0000. Simultaneously, the firm sold 434,000 shares at prices between $10.0750 and $10.6800, amounting to USD 4,589,898.0000. These dealings, disclosed under Rule 22 of the Hong Kong Code on Takeovers and Mergers, suggest a possible mandatory general offer for Bright Smart Securities. Morgan Stanley & Co., International plc is classified as a Class (5) associate linked to the Offeror, with all dealings executed for its own account, and ultimately owned by Morgan Stanley.
